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breathalyzer
  • Blood test
  • Saliva test
  • Urine test
  • Hair analysis

Breathalyzer - Used for immediate alcohol level evaluation.

Blood test - Provides precise BAC readings for legal cases.

Saliva test - Quick, non-invasive method for recent alcohol use.

Urine test - Detects alcohol consumption over a longer period.

Hair analysis - Reflects long-term alcohol consumption patterns.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ing in Rock Valley, Iowa offers an innovative way to detect drug exposure over the long term by analyzing the keratin in nails.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Detects drug use from past 4-6 months
  • Toenails: Offers extended detection up to 12 months

What Drugs Can Be Detected

  • Cocaine
  • Opiates
  • Amphetamines
  • THC
  • Benzodiazepines
  • Barbiturates

Advantages over other methods

  • Long detection period
  • Less invasive than blood tests
  • Stable samples not affected by washing
  • Non-gender specific
  • Environmental drug exposure can be detected
  • Can reveal historical drug use patterns

Common Types of Occupational Health Tests

  • Fitness for duty exams: Validates employee capability to perform specific job tasks.
  • Respirator Fit Testing: Ensures proper fit of safety gear.
  • Pulmonary Function Tests (PFT's): Measures lung capacity for jobs with exposure to respiratory risks.
  • Tuberculosis (TB): Screen for TB in high-risk environments.
  • Vision Testing: Ensures vision standards are met.
  • Audiometric Testing: Checks hearing ability for specific job requirements.
